Abstract

The utility model relates to a regulating valve, comprising a valve body and a valve rod; wherein, a top of the valve body is provided with an air pressure inlet; the valve rod is in an inverted T shape, a bottom of the valve rod is provided with a block matched with the valve rod; an upper part of the valve rod is provided with a spring; and an upper part of the spring is provided with an air film. The regulating valve of the utility model consists of the valve body, the valve rod, the spring, the air film, the block, and so on, and has the advantages of simple structure, low cost, less fault, and easy maintenance. The regulating valve of the utility model realizes open of the valve by utilizing a downward thrust from an air pressure signal to the air film to drive the valve rod to move downwards, maintains balance through an elastic force of the spring, and can regulate flow of the valve by controlling the size of the air pressure signal.

Description

A kind of modulating valve
Technical field
The utility model relates to a kind of valving, specifically a kind of modulating valve.
Background technique
In the automatic control system of modern chemical industry factory, because the correct distribution and the control of mobile liquids and gases are depended in the production of factory, so modulating valve plays crucial effect in automatic control system.Modulating valve generally adopts power type or electric liquid type to realize distant control at present, but these two kinds of control modes all have complex structure, cost is high and troublesome shortcoming, in the small-sized electric control system, is difficult to a large amount of uses.
The model utility content
The purpose of the utility model just provides a kind of modulating valve, to solve complex structure and the high problem of cost that existing modulating valve exists.
The utility model is achieved in that a kind of modulating valve; Include valve body and the valve rod that is located at valve inner; Have the air pressure inlet at said valve body top, said valve rod is an inverted T shape, and the sprue that matches with valve rod is arranged in said stem bottom; Top at said valve rod is provided with spring, is provided with air film on said spring top.
The utility model is made up of the parts such as valve rod, spring, air film and sprue that are arranged in the valve body, and it is simple in structure, and cost is low, thereby has guaranteed that fault is few, even be out of order also easy-maintaining.The utility model is through air pressure signal the downward thrust of air film to be driven valve rod to move downward the unlatching that realizes valve, and keeps balance through the elastic force of spring, can accomplish the adjusting of valve flow through the size of control air pressure signal.
Description of drawings
Fig. 1 is the structural representation of the utility model.
Among the figure: 1, air pressure inlet, 2, air film, 3, spring, 4, valve rod, 5, valve body, 6, sprue.
Embodiment
As shown in Figure 1, the utility model includes valve body 5, has air pressure inlet 1 at the top of valve body 5; Be provided with air film 2 at the top of valve body 5; Below air film 2, be connected with spring 3, spring bottom is connected with the valve rod 4 of inverted T shape, is provided with the sprue 6 that matches with valve rod in the bottom of valve rod 4.
The work engineering of the utility model is: at first, air pressure signal is fed valve body 5 from air pressure inlet 1, air pressure produces a downward thrust on air film 2, and driving spring 3 moves down with valve rod 4, and this modulating valve is opened.Simultaneously, spring 3 is compressed the back air film 2 is produced a reaction force that makes progress, when the reaction force of spring 3 equates with the thrust of air pressure signal on air film 2, and valve rod 4 stop motions, modulating valve promptly is in stable opening state.The enter the mouth pressure of pressure signal at 1 place of air pressure is big more, and the thrust on air film 2 is also just big more, and the decrement of spring 3 is that the aperture of this modulating valve is also with regard to corresponding increase.
